Quote:
Other question, don't know if is real. In Torpedo Run, when they rise the attack periscope, the skipper was on his knees almost every time, in other scenes they put the periscope all the way up. So, american subs had 2 positions for the attack scope or a free height control like SH3 (or like u-boats or other subs, correct if wrong).
At least for part of the war the attack scope had variable height control as shown in SH3. Perhaps all of it, not sure. Beach speaks of "the pickle" as the switch used by the periscope assistant (usually a quartermaster) to adjust the scope height as ordered by the Approach Officer.
